When using ES6 modules it was not possible to identify which module an error originates from. This PR changes the error message to also include the file path using the file:line:column format, and updates the source context printing for unhandled exceptions to use the correct file. #if !ENABLED (JERRY_SYSTEM_ALLOCATOR)
|
|
/**
|
|
* Heap structure
|
|
*
|
|
* Memory blocks returned by the allocator must not start from the
|
|
* beginning of the heap area because offset 0 is reserved for
|
|
* JMEM_CP_NULL. This special constant is used in several places,
|
|
* e.g. it marks the end of the property chain list, so it cannot
|
|
* be eliminated from the project. Although the allocator cannot
|
|
* use the first 8 bytes of the heap, nothing prevents to use it
|
|
* for other purposes. Currently the free region start is stored
|
|
* there.
|
|
*/
|
|
typedef struct jmem_heap_t jmem_heap_t;
|
|
#endif /* !ENABLED (JERRY_SYSTEM_ALLOCATOR) */
